Many of basil’s health … Witryna10 kwi 2024 · Seed Thai basil about a quarter-inch deep in a spot with moist, well-drained soil and full to part sun. Plant or thin Thai basil seedlings to put about 12 inches between plants. You can also plant Thai basil seeds or seedlings in containers. Thai basil plants bloom in mid-to-late summer, depending on your region.
